Output ca3dcc177c18c7766faf425a04d0459d99dfc6001f99023e1063fac02fd52b83:11

value
567022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1acafde236c5294cc60c458ea7adb8c7624ee42 OP_EQUALVERIFY OP_CHECKSIG
address
1MaFufVzx4KbM3PCbnL9yStK4inwAbe1fd
transaction
ca3dcc177c18c7766faf425a04d0459d99dfc6001f99023e1063fac02fd52b83
spent
true